Tony and Wendy Word have been involved in Southern Gospel and Christian Country music for the biggest part of their lives. This year has been a tremendous success for the popular Wendy Word + forgiven, as they have racked up 3 Diamond Award Nominations and released a new, “What’s Wrong with Doing Right” on the Crossroads March Sampler.The song is predicted to be another success for this duet who has garnered nominations and exposure from many Southern Gospel and Christian Country outlets and charts, including 3 Diamond Awards nominations this year. But most importantly to the duet is the call to minister with their music and resources. Recently, the couple felt a call in their hearts to sponsor a missionary trip to Haiti. The trip helped to reach out to those hurting from the recent devastation there. One example of the help was with a small boy, Junior. Wendy notes, “His mother beat him in the back of the head with a knife so badly, his skull was deformed. We know that the disaster in Haiti could not be prevented, but to make a difference in a small way with missions such as these is very important to us. Many children were orphaned, like Junior. We were blessed to help out and hope and pray missions that sponsor relief to disaster areas such as these will continue.”

The newly released song, penned by Wendy, contains a relevant message for today, as it encourages people to just do the right thing. Wendy Word + forgiven will be featured in the 2nd Annual Branson Gospel Music Convention taking place in Branson, MO, June 28-July 2. The 2010 Diamond Awards ceremony is slated for July 1 during the convention; the duet has received nominations in these categories: Duet of the Year, Christian Country Group of the Year, and Female Artist of the Year for Wendy’s contributions in Christian Country.
